Works

Crabbe, Rev. George

Five volumes: A complete set of the poet and minister's work, 'Nature's sternest painter, yet the best', according to Byron; as well as portrayer of the commonplace realities and downside of human life; and the man Jane Austen dreamed of marrying (did nobody inform her of the author's opium addiction?)

Publisher: John Murray 1823
Place Published: London
Calf and marbled boards. Bookplate and small abrasion to front free endpaper vol.1, corners scuffed and light wear. Very good. The five vols.
